Northern Africa. Abraham Ortelius, Africae Propriae Tabula, in qua, Punica Regna Vides; Tyrios, et Agenoris Urbem, from Theatrum Orbis Terrarum, 1590 (dated). Hand Color. Very decorative map of the coastline covering present-day Tunisia and Libya based on Gastaldi's great map of Africa and the ancient texts of Diodorus, Siculus, Plinius, Virgilius, Appianus, Halicarnasseus, Athenaeus, and Herodotus. The map extends to include Sicily and Malta. It includes a fabulous strapwork title cartouche and a large cartouche at bottom containing text and an inset plan of Carthage. This is the first state with Latin text on verso, published in 1603.
LITERATURE: Van den Broecke #218.
